Elizabeth (Alaska) What is the policy regarding making a listopia static?


message 2: by Vicky (new)

Vicky (librovert) | 2462 comments When you create a new list there is an option to make the list static. I have the option when I edit lists to change a list to static (though I can't find a static list to check to see if I can revert a list that has already been made static). I'm not sure if that's because I am a super or if any librarian can make that change.

It's been a while since I was super active in the librarians group, so I'm not sure what the official policy may be. But it seems to me that since the option is there on creation any list creator has the ability to make their list static initially with no questions asked. Changing the status of the list would be up for debate - but I would think that if someone can claim that they reasonably made a list for a specific purpose that would lend itself to being static (award nominee lists come to mind), there's no reason not to make it static.


Elizabeth (Alaska) I'm fairly certain that not only regular GR members do not have that ability, but not even regular librarians. I thought only staff could do it, but if you can as a super, then that is the threshold. Surely there is a policy, because listopia is a community resource and it shouldn't be that just any list can be made static.


message 4: by rivka, Former Moderator (new)

rivka | 45177 comments Mod
Only supers and staff can set a list as static.

There should be a good reason to do so. What constitutes a good enough reason has not been formally defined.
